The "SQL Server 2012 CLR and SMO" runtimes released by "rev23dev" are available for download on InstallAware FTP server.

http://www.installaware.com/ia_sql2012_clr_smo.zip

PLEASE NOTE!
To use the above runtimes, the contents of the compressed file must be manually copied in the RUNTIMES folder of InstallAware installation directory.
That generally should be:
C:\Program Files (x86)\InstallAware\InstallAware 2012\runtimes

I couldn't find SP1 versions of my SMO / CLR packages anymore, I had since moved on to SP2. The versioning got a little weird with SP2 and what Visual Studio would install on my dev PC.

Anyways, I have versions for 2014 if you need them.

They're not that hard to build basing them off the one that I originally uploaded. You need to replace the setup exes in their folders, and in the check script you need to alter the product code for the version you're installing.

I install the ones I want, then locate them in H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all... that's where I grabbed the product code from (there may be a better way to do this?)

So, like I said, if you use the original CLR/SMO as a base, you can keep them updated with just minimal effort.
